Any Bluetooth device should be detectable by another Bluetooth device, regardless of their Bluetooth class. The issue will only come in once you pair the device.

There could be a possibility that the headset is not set to "discoverable mode" or "pairing mode". Or the two devices could be away from the required distance.

3 meters is the required distance for two class 1 Bluetooth devices.

If the headset is in pairing mode and in the required distance, make sure that there's no other Bluetooth device that's connected to the phone.

Then, turn both devices (phone and headset) off, and try searching again.

If same problem occur, try detecting a known working headset. And if the phone does detect it, then you need to contact the manufacturer of the headset for second opinion.

I m not able to connect my BH 208 headset to nokia E71 set

Make sure that the headset is properly charged before following the instructions below.Please follow the detailed instructions in the correct manner to successfully pair your Nokia E71 with the BH-208 Headset.
Charge the battery

The headset has an internal, non removable, rechargeable battery.Do not attempt to remove the battery from the device, as you may damage the device.
1. Connect the charger to a wall outlet.
2. Connect the charger cable to the charger connector. The red indicator light is on while charging.
It may take a while before charging
Switch the headset on or off
To switch on, press and hold the power key until the headset beeps and the green indicator light is displayed. To switch off, press and hold the power key until the headset beeps and the red indicator light is displayed briefly.
Pairing the headset
1. Ensure that your phone is switched on and the headset is switched off.
2. Press and hold the power key until the green indicator light starts to flash quickly.
3. Activate the Bluetooth feature on the phone, and set the phone to search for Bluetooth devices.
4. Select the headset from the list of found devices.
5. Enter the passcode 0000 to pair and connect the headset to your phone. In some phones you may need to make the connection separately after pairing. You only need to pair the headset with your phone once.
If the pairing is successful, the headset beeps and appears in the phone menu where you can view the currently paired Bluetooth devices.The headset is now ready for use.

Can i have how to connect Nokia BH-214 bluetooth headset pair in acer laptop(Asper5742)

from OFF state of your BH-214, press power button until LED flashes quickly,do not unhold, stay holding & press power button until LED flashes red & blue alternately slowly.On ur PC,->Add new device, then your PC would detect BH-214 as headset. I used Toshiba Bluetooth stack v7.00.10(T) driver Win7x64 (search in google to download the installer), work fine with my BH-214 to connect with PC (A2DP 1.2 (btooth audio profile) & AVRCP (player navigation control profile)) & at the same time with my phone (HFP, HandsFree profile). Applied CSR bluetooth dongle 2.0, got from store for only $2.50.

Can not remember how to pair my nokia bh208 headst

Try this:

Pair the headset
1. Ensure that your phone is switched on and the headset is
switched off.
2. Press and hold the power key until the green indicator light
starts to flash quickly.
3. Activate the Bluetooth feature on the phone, and set the phone
to search for Bluetooth devices.
4. Select the headset from the list of found devices.
5. Enter the passcode 0000 to pair and connect the headset to your phone. In some phones you may need to make the connection separately after pairing.

You only need to pair the headset with your phone once.
If the pairing is successful, the headset beeps and appears in the
phone menu where you can view the currently paired Bluetooth
devices. The headset is now ready to use.

Nokia 6102i will not detect my BH-600

Hey I found the solution :
1. When the headset is off, press and hold the multifunction key until the indicator light is continuously displayed.

2. Switch on your compatible phone.

3. Activate the Bluetooth feature on the phone, and set the phone to search for Bluetooth devices.

4. Select the headset from the list of
found devices.

5. Enter the passcode 0000 to pair and connect the headset to your phone.

In some phones you may need to make the connection separately after pairing. You only need to pair the headset with your phone once.

If the pairing is successful, the indicator light starts to flash slowly, and the headset appears in the phone menu where you can view the currently paired Bluetooth devices.

The headset is now ready for use.
